About The Position

EY is seeking a Java Software Developer to join their Service Delivery Center (SDC) within the Financial Services Office (FSO). The SDC comprises high-performing US-based colleagues who collaborate with experienced advisory professionals to deliver technology project-based work and managed services to clients. In this role, you will be responsible for the design, build/configuration, testing, analysis, delivery, and support of technology solutions. This is a fast-paced and dynamic position requiring flexibility, self-starting abilities, and the capacity to manage changing priorities and learn new technologies rapidly. The role involves collaborating with clients to transform their businesses through disruptive innovation and transformational design solutions, modernizing systems, processes, and products to enhance business and customer-facing platforms. The team leverages Microservices, Cloud, Omni channel integration, API Management, and open-source technologies to enable end-to-end automation.
